Earl Christian Campbell was born to Ann and Bert "B.C." Campbell, on March 29, 1955, in Tyler, Texas, leading to the eponymous nickname, "the Tyler Rose" later in his career. [12], Campbell led the nation in rushing as a senior in 1977, with 1,744 yards and 19 touchdowns. Earl Campbell was named the NFL's Offensive Player of the Year in each of his first three seasons, during which he averaged nearly 1,700 rushing yards per season.
